How many Dodge Stealth were made?


The Dodge Stealth, a sports car produced in the 1990s, is often remembered for its sleek design and impressive performance. As a unique collaboration between Dodge and Mitsubishi, the Stealth was part of a larger family of vehicles that included the Mitsubishi 3000GT. Production Overview


The Dodge Stealth was manufactured from 1990 to 1996, during which time it gained a reputation for its powerful engines and advanced technology for its era. The total production numbers for the Dodge Stealth are estimated to be around 30,000 units. This figure includes various trims and models that were available throughout its production run.


Model Variants


The Dodge Stealth was offered in several different variants, each catering to different performance and luxury preferences:



  • Stealth ES: The base model, featuring a V6 engine and a focus on comfort.

  • Stealth R/T: A more performance-oriented version with a turbocharged engine.

  • Stealth R/T Turbo: The top-tier model, boasting enhanced power and performance features.


Significance in Automotive History


The Dodge Stealth holds a special place in the hearts of car enthusiasts. It was one of the few American sports cars of its time that offered all-wheel drive and a twin-turbocharged engine option. The collaboration with Mitsubishi allowed Dodge to leverage advanced technology, making the Stealth a competitive player in the sports car market during the 1990s.

Is the Dodge Stealth just a 3000GT?


In North America, it was sold both as the Mitsubishi 3000GT (1991–1999) and the Dodge Stealth (1991–1996), a badge engineered, mechanically identical captive import. As a collaborative effort between Chrysler and Mitsubishi Motors, Chrysler was responsible for the Stealth's exterior styling.
